37 #include <libkern/quad.h>
38 
39 /*
40  * Return remainder after dividing two signed quads.
41  *
42  * XXX
43  * If -1/2 should produce -1 on this machine, this code is wrong.
44  */
45 quad_t
46 __moddi3(a, b)
47  quad_t a, b;
48 {
49  u_quad_t ua, ub, ur;
50  int neg;
51 
52  if (a < 0)
53  ua = -(u_quad_t)a, neg = 1;
54  else
55  ua = a, neg = 0;
56  if (b < 0)
57  ub = -(u_quad_t)b;
58  else
59  ub = b;
60  (void)__qdivrem(ua, ub, &ur);
61  return (neg ? -ur : ur);
62 }
